Why not just save the downloaded QuickTime file and extract the audio track from it instead of recompressing? You'll get the exact AAC track that was given to you. Just go to /private/tmp/[userIDNumber]/TemporaryItems, and the file will be there.

Also note that the audio tracks in the music videos are 32 kHz AAC, not 44.1 kHz.
